January 26, 2022 Updates to the Board of Health Face Covering Order in Acton 


The provisions of the Emergency Order of the Acton Board of Health as of January 26, 2022, requiring Face Coverings in Indoor Public Places are hereby adopted by the Town of Acton.

  • All individuals, including the public and employees entering any public business premises, including but not limited to grocery stores, pharmacies, houses of worship, fitness centers, all personal care services (examples: salon, barbershop, nail care, etc), home improvement or retail stores and the like must cover their mouth and nose with a mask or cloth face covering, unless exempted by MDPH guidance https://www.mass.gov/info-details/covid-19-mask-requirements
  • All individuals, including the public and employees entering a restaurant or food establishment premises for purposes of picking up food for takeout must cover their mouth and nose with a mask or cloth face covering, or if dining in, once seated, the mask can be removed while eating and drinking only, unless exempted by MDPH guidance https://www.mass.gov/info- details/covid-19-mask-requirements
  • All individuals, including the public and employees entering an indoor municipal property or building, including but not limited to the Acton Public Safety Facility, Acton Town Hall, Acton Memorial and Citizens Library and Acton Fire Stations, must cover their mouth and nose with a mask or cloth face covering, unless exempted MDPH guidance https://www.mass.gov/info-details/covid-19-mask-requirements
  • All entry doors of businesses open to the public must post a sign advising all individuals that face coverings must be worn inside the establishment.  The sign must be 8 ½ X 11 inches or not less than 5 X 8 inches and the words shall be large enough to be read at a distance of six feet.
  • In addition to the above and in accordance with the mask mandate regulated by the Commonwealth of Massachusetts, masks will also remain mandatory for all individuals on public and private transportation systems (including rideshares, livery, taxi, ferries, MBTA, Commuter Rail and transportation stations), in healthcare facilities and in other settings hosting vulnerable populations, such as congregate care settings, unless exempted MDPH guidance https://www.mass.gov/info-details/covid-19-mask-requirements
